Secret Factors to Consider Before Clicking "Add to Cart"
Shopping for a treadmill online indicates one can not check the machine in person before purchasing. For that reason, buyers need to count on specs, measurements, and research study. Here are the most crucial elements to examine:
1. Motor Power (CHP)
Continuous Horsepower (CHP) determines the power output of the motor over a continual period. The appropriate CHP depends entirely on the user's primary activity:
- Walking: 2.0 to 2.5 CHP is sufficient.
- Running: 2.5 to 3.0 CHP is suggested.
- Running/Heavy Use: 3.0 CHP or higher is required to deal with intense, day-to-day workouts.
2. Belt Size
The dimensions of the running surface area dictate convenience and safety.
- Height under 5'8": A 45-to-50-inch long belt may suffice for strolling.
- Typical to Tall Runners: A minimum length of 55 to 60 inches and a width of 20 inches is ideal to accommodate a natural stride without the risk of stepping off the edge.
3. Weight Capacity
Constantly examine the optimum user weight limit. As a guideline of thumb, it is a good idea to pick a compact treadmill with a weight capacity a minimum of 50 pounds much heavier than the heaviest designated user. This makes sure structural stability and reduces motor strain.
4. Folding vs. Non-Folding
Space is typically the deciding consider home health club design. Folding treadmills feature hydraulic systems that allow the deck to lift vertically when not in use. Non-folding models (often discovered in business settings) use remarkable stability and a stronger feel, however they require a long-term footprint.

Purchasing a big, costly item online needs a bit of technique. Keep these ideas in mind to ensure a smooth transaction:
- Measure Twice, Buy Once: Measure the designated workout space, keeping ceiling height in mind (specifically if the treadmill has a slope). Don't forget to measure entrances, hallways, and stairwells to guarantee the boxed maker can actually get in the space.
- Understand the Warranty: A quality treadmill ought to come with a strong service warranty. Look for life time protection on the frame and motor, a minimum of 1 to 3 years on parts, and 1 year on labor.
- Inspect Return Policies: Treadmills are notoriously tough to return due to their size and weight. Constantly check out the merchant's return policy thoroughly, noting whether you are accountable for return shipping charges or a restocking fee.
- Invest in Professional Assembly: Many online sellers provide "White Glove Delivery," where a team brings the treadmill in uk within, assembles it in your space of option, and carries away the product packaging. Offered the intricacy of contemporary treadmills, this add-on is typically well worth the expense.

2. Do I need to pay for a subscription to utilize a smart treadmill?
It depends on the design. Many high-end clever treadmills (like those including incorporated touchscreens) need a regular monthly membership to access live and on-demand classes. However, many devices offer a "Manual Mode" that permits you to operate the treadmill without a membership.
3. How much area do I need around a treadmill?
For security factors, manufacturers normally suggest leaving a minimum of 6 to 8 feet of clearance behind the treadmill compact and 2 feet of clearance on both sides. This guarantees that if you slip or fall, you have a safe buffer zone.
4. What maintenance does an online-bought treadmill require?
The majority of home treadmills need basic regular maintenance to extend their lifespan. This includes:
- Regularly cleaning down sweat to prevent deterioration.
- Vacuuming dust underneath the belt.
- Oiling the strolling belt every 3 to 6 months with silicone-based lube.
